The paper examines web applications that use TLS-terminating intermediaries,
such as CDNs and WAFs. I developed and evaluated a prototype that uses HTTP
Message Signatures, Content-Digest, and selective field-level encryption to
protect communication beyond the TLS intermediary.

I am investigating whether the relevant functionality could instead be
integrated into browsers. In such a model, the browser could verify signed
responses before exposing them to the page, generate an origin-bound key for
signing selected requests, and retrieve the origin's verification key through
a trusted mechanism.
